Household of Anne Tordeux

She is married to Klaas Tit.

Permission for the marriage has been obtained in Haarlem on August 11, 1771.Source 4

They were married in church on August 25, 1771 at Haarlem.


Child(ren):

  1. Johannes Tit  1772-????
  2. Johannes Tit  1776-????
  3. Petrus Tit  1778-1853 
  4. Jacobus Tit  1781-????
